For 120 Hz output with 60 Hz motor, set Jumper J4 to the “2X” position and
be sure Jumper J5 is set to the “60Hz” position. For 100 Hz output with 50
Hz motor, set Jumper J4 to the “2X” position and set Jumper J5 to the “50Hz”
position. See Figure 14.

6.5 RUN/FAULT OUTPUT RELAY OPERATION (J6): Jumper J6 is factory set to the “RUN”
position for “Run” operation of the Run/Fault Relay. For “Fault” operation of the Run/Fault
Relay, set Jumper J6 to the “FLT” position. See Figure 15.

7 TRIMPOT ADJUSTMENTS
The drive contains trimpots that are factory set for most applications. See Figure 3, on page
12, for the location of the trimpots and their approximate factory calibrated positions. Some
applications may require readjustment of the trimpots in order to set the drive for a specific
requirement. The trimpots may be readjusted as described.
WARNING! IF POSSIBLE, DO NOT ADJUST TRIMPOTS WITH THE MAIN
POWER APPLIED. IF ADJUSTMENTS ARE MADE WITH THE MAIN POWER APPLIED, AN
INSULATED ADJUSTMENT TOOL MUST BE USED AND SAFETY GLASSES MUST BE
WORN. HIGH VOLTAGE EXISTS IN THIS DRIVE. FIRE AND/OR ELECTROCUTION CAN
RESULT IF CAUTION IS NOT EXERCISED. “ALL” SAFETY WARNINGS ON, PAGE 8,
MUST BE READ AND UNDERSTOOD BEFORE
PROCEEDING.
7.1 MINIMUM SPEED (MIN): Sets the minimum
speed of the motor. The MIN Trimpot is factory
set to 0% of frequency setting. For a higher
minimum speed, setting, rotate the MIN Trimpot
clockwise. See Figure 16.
